Keep It Covered, and Don’t Forget the Screen Protector
Dropping your iPhone is an inevitable event. A case can help you avoid a broken iPhone.
If you want to keep your device slim and light, a silicone protective
case can provide flexible protection. For something more protective,
look for a hard polymer case that is shock resistant for all those bumps
and drops. Clear cases maintain the look of your iPhone, but you can
also find colorful designs that add a little bit of personality to your
phone. Add a screen protector to help prevent scratches, and you have a
full spectrum of defense.

Have a Dedicated Spot for Your Phone in Your Car and Home
If you designate a specific spot for your iPhone in both your care and
home, you can make sure that it is always protected. A wireless charging
stand or pad is the perfect spot for your home. In your car, look for a
mount compatible with your case. These accessories keep your phone in a
secure location. This can help prevent loss, as well as accidental
bumps and scrapes.
Have a Case that Has an Added Grip
When looking for a case, you should test out models with a grip that
can pop in and out. This feature gives your iPhone an extra point of
contact while it is in your hand. Instead of your fingers resting on a
smooth back, they can rest on a grip that helps you keep your phone
secure. A grip like this also provides a stand and can connect with
mounts in your car.
